Output d58340b02fbb4e9f920a03dc68eb964d04eb7bfa05051aedfb36e78efc8ed452:1

value
2142989
script pubkey
OP_0 OP_PUSHBYTES_20 668e63e53a9122ab91a35054014c5b81e1e2a73c
address
bc1qv68x8ef6jy32hydr2p2qznzms8s79feuvv968e
transaction
d58340b02fbb4e9f920a03dc68eb964d04eb7bfa05051aedfb36e78efc8ed452
confirmations
61050
spent
true